#13901c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#13901c is composed of 7.5% red, 56.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 124.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 32%. #13901c color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ff38 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#13901c color description : Dark lime green.

#13901c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#13901c has RGB values of R:19, G:144,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1282076.

Shades and Tints of #13901c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#13901c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b584c is the less saturated color, while #00a30c is the most saturated one.
